Research objectives and content
The aim of this project will be to develop nanophase composites based on two system (Al-Ni-Sn and Fe-Nb-B)obtained by two different process (rapid solidification and mechanical alloying). for two important industrial application of nanoscale materials: mechanical and magnetic properties. The structure and the thermal stability of these alloys produced by melt-spinning and by ball-milling will be investigated by XRD,TEM,DSC and TGA. The technological objective will be to optimise and control the nanostructure to improve hardness and wear resistance (Al-based alloys), and to obtain the best soft magnetic properties (Fe-based alloys). The Fundamental objective will be to understand the behaviour of nanophase composites by a comparative approach to these two systems.
